What is a doc?

A Doc, short for Doctor, is a medical professional who is trained and licensed to diagnose, treat, and help prevent diseases and injuries in patients. Doctors can work in various specialties, such as family medicine, surgery, pediatrics, or cardiology, and may provide care in hospitals, clinics, or private practices. They are responsible for examining patients, ordering and interpreting diagnostic tests, prescribing medications, and offering advice on health and wellness. Becoming a doctor requires extensive education and training, including medical school and residency. Doctors play a critical role in maintaining and improving the health of individuals and communities.

What are some common challenges faced by doctors when working in a multidisciplinary healthcare team?

Doctors often collaborate with nurses, pharmacists, therapists, and administrative staff to deliver patient care. A common challenge is ensuring clear communication among team members, as misunderstandings can impact treatment outcomes. Balancing input from various specialists while maintaining responsibility for patient decisions requires strong leadership and diplomacy. Adapting to different working styles and managing time effectively during interdisciplinary meetings are also important aspects of the role.

Westborough Behavioral Healthcare Hospital (WBHH) is seeking board-certified or eligible Psychiatrist to join our team in Westborough, MA. You will report directly to the Chief Medical Officer, and will be responsible for providing treatment for both newly admitted and current patients. This requires working collaboratively with a multidisciplinary team to provide subacute medical care to patients with acute medical problems, chronic illness, or requesting preventive health services. Medical services include performing history and physical examination, ordering and interpretation of laboratory, radiologic and other diagnostic procedures, and integration of consultant recommendations into the patient care treatment plan in collaboration with other disciplines on the team.

All DOC shifts begin at 4 pm and end at 8 am.  The DOC shift schedule is as follows:

  • Each Thursday and Friday evening,
  • One to two weekends each month, shift 8am- 4pm
  • Holidays that fall on the schedule shown above, and
  • Vacation gap coverage.
  • $750 per shift

As the DOC you must be available by phone and able to return calls within 10 minutes of the call. There are occasions when it is necessary to be face to face with the patient. In such circumstances in-person presence in the hospital is required. There are overnight sleep accommodations at the hospital for the DOC.
